X-Yachts XC 35 Buyer's Guide
Shopping the brokerage market for an X-Yachts Xc 35 means considering a small, limited-production Danish cruiser built from 2014 to 2019, with only thirty hulls afloat. Niels Jeppesen drew her as the entry to the Xcruising range, and the boat’s restrained beam and single rudder mark her as a sailor’s cruiser rather than a volume charterer. Buyers will find a consistent specimen because the yard built her to one layout and the structural approach — a screwed galvanized steel grid with foam-cored E-glass skins — does not vary across the class.
Layouts on the Used Market
Every Xc 35 on the used market is the same two-cabin, one-head arrangement, a consequence of the rather narrow stern that prevents a sensible second aft cabin. The forward stateroom takes a double V-berth with usable foot room; the aft cabin reaches past the centerline but is tight for two because the engine cover intrudes. The saloon’s two settees convert to berths over six and a half feet long, and a full-size nav desk sits opposite the head aft to starboard. The galley is aft to port with twin centerline sinks and a top-loading fridge, and a hanging wet locker plus a large cockpit-accessed locker abaft the head cover provisioning and wet gear.
Equipment and Common Upgrades
On the used boat, a dodger, swim platform, and teak decks are commonly fitted, shaping the visual and functional profile most buyers will meet. Less universal but seen are heating, radar, AIS, autopilot, and chartplotter as owner additions. For a buyer’s consequences, the meaningful clusters are canvas and cockpit — the standard fixed aluminum-framed windshield option and the fold-down transom with twin wheels — and sail-handling power, where the standard Harken Performa self-tailers may be upgraded to Andersen, and a GRP furling boom or self-tailing jib for heavy-air cruising may appear. Navigation and comfort upgrades such as autopilot and heating matter more than stereos for liveaboard use.
What to Inspect
The structural grid is screwed to the hull to avoid tension cracking, so check for any hull-grid joint distress at the three floor-timber cross-members. The mainsheet led to the companionway top with a simple bridle was found unsatisfactory on the test boat, so verify what traveler or bridle refinement an individual hull carries. The head commode on the test example was too small, and a pass-through from the head to the cockpit locker was missing — confirm whether later upgrades addressed these. The engine space is tight but should show three-sided access and intact sound insulation around the Yanmar saildrive.
Availability and Buyer's Takeaway
The Xc 35 turns up in the United States and Croatia. For a buyer, the checklist is short: confirm the single two-cabin layout meets your berth needs, inspect the steel grid joint and early deck-trim fixes, and weigh whether the commonly fitted dodger and teak suit your maintenance appetite. A narrow stern limits aft space, but the full nav station and cockpit-accessed storage make her a credible small offshore cruiser.
